Addressing The Gender Pay Gap: Why Equal Pay Is Not The Only Solution

Sometimes, when I reach out to technology companies to find out what they’re doing to close their gender pay gap, they tell me “We don’t have a problem, we have an equal pay policy.” You can have an equal pay policy and still have a gender pay gap. The two are related, but they are not the same.

In this episode, we explore the difference between an equal pay policy and the gender pay gap so that you understand how your employer is offering equal pay and still have a gender pay gap. In order to close your gender pay gap, your organization needs to think more broadly about how to attract, retain, engage, and develop more women through the talent pipeline.
